Argentina reached the end of World Cup Qatar 2022 after beating the Croatian team 3-0. In a fantastic match for the South Americans, the captain and seven times Ballon d’Or, Lionel Messi, he took all eyes by scoring a goal and providing an assist; with this, he reaches a total of five scores and three assists in the competition.
Previously, Messi had surpassed Maradona as the Argentine with the most matches played in the World Cups, also leaving Batistuta behind as the team’s top scorer in the tournament.
However, this afternoon, against Croatia, the ’10’ from PSG managed to equalize the German Lotthar Matthaus as the player with the most games played (25) in the World Cup. And, if nothing serious happens, he will overcome it this Friday in the grand final.
Messi arrived at Qatar 2022 with 19 World Cup appearances and 6 goals in total. Figures that he has managed to exceed by far during this edition of the World Cup thanks to the superlative level that he has been showing.
